Evaluation of the Patient with Acute and Chronic Diarrhea

Clinical questions to be addressed:

What, if any, work-up should ensue for the patient with acute diarrhea?
Which patients should receive prophylaxis for traveler's diarrhea?
What basic work-up should be done for the evaluation of chronic diarrhea? How do the clinical clues help?
Celiac disease: Who should be screened, and what are the mimics to consider before starting a gluten-free diet?
Who is at risk for bacterial overgrowth, and how should antibiotics be effectively used?
What is the treatment algorithm for microscopic colitis, and what do I do with patients who relapse?
